Product Details

This product is known as shock cord or bungee cord. It will stretch to 100% of its original length. Comes in white with black tracers.
  • Known as bungee cord or shock cord
  • Stretches to 100% of original length
  • Rubber core
  • White with black tracers

                  A:  I have used this for face masks but I did not sew it. I make my masks with tunnels on the sides. I thread this cord from the bottom up on one side then from the top down on the other side and tie the two ends together so it is one continuous loop. You can wear your mask around your neck to have it ready to wear at a moments notice. Just put the mask over your face and pull the top loop up onto your head. I works great! If you want just ear loops, you could thread it through the tunnel, cut it, tie a knot and hide the knot in the tunnel. I haven't tried this yet so I don't know how comfortable it would be. Also, because it is rubber, I don't know how it would react in a commercial situation like a hospital washing machine. It washes and dries just fine in my home. Good luck and thanks for making masks!

                      A:  Possibly. Some experimentation required. First, I assume you are using this to replace the elastic head straps. Second, fastening this to face mask will be difficult because I don't believe you can sew through this with a regular sewing needle or even a leather needle. The Boss(aka Wife) informs me that a wide zig zag stitch that does not try to go through cord might work. Placing a knot in the end of the cord would probably be required. An alternative would be to heat the end of the cord with a torch and melt the end to create a blob as well as preventing fraying. You could try fastening cord to mask using either a grommet(s) in the mask or reenforced button hole(s). One idea would be to use 1/4" heat shrink tubing. Run cord through hole and then back on itself. Push 1" piece of 1/4" heat shrink tubing over cord and shrink tight. Second idea would require you locating a metal collar that could be crimped over the cord ends instead of the heat shrink e.g ~1/4" brass tubing cut 1/4" or 1/2" lengths. Keep in mind this cord should only be stretched by 50% of its original length. And it is no where as "elastic" as the normal straps on these types of masks. Good luck.
